| dc.description.abstract | The physical, phase, and grain-size properties of deposits are examined as obtained on treating industrial and simulated effluents by means of an electrically generated reagent: ferroferric hydrosol. The use of the deposits in producing iron-bearing pigments is considered. | eng |
